Simplex Remote Telemetry Gateway Receiver for Asset Tracking and Remote Monitoring Networks: Application Note
A network operator has an Enterprise data network that provides global coverage through the use of a constellation of satellites and corresponding gateway Earth stations. The customer offered simplex data services focused on asset tracking and remote sensor monitoring applications that consist of low bandwidth, infrequent transmissions that are very low power. The customer acquired Spectrum’s flexComm Simplex Remote Telemetry Gateway Receiver with the Back Office Server Software Package that provided their earth stations with significantly increased capacity as well as increased sensitivity.

Finding MIMO: A Proposed Model for Incorporating Multiple Input, Multiple Output Technology into Software Defined Radios (pdf)
This paper explores how Multiple Input, Multiple Output (MIMO) capabilities can be inserted into radio systems in a cost affective manner after those radios are already in service. This paper also proposes a model using software defined radio technology as a key enabler in allowing today's emerging wireless systems to support the future insertion of MIMO technology while minimizing overall capital investment.
